Sorry Oklahoma, but Ole Miss has emerged as the SEC’s Cinderella in Nashville following consecutive upset wins over Texas and Georgia as the #15 seed in the conference tournament. Chris Beard is a great coach, so it’s not exactly surprising to see one of his teams surging in postseason play. However, if I’m being honest, it’s mildly surprising to see this team in the quarterfinals. It’s not that Texas and Georgia are some sort of college basketball titans, because they aren’t, but the Rebels were horrible for the final month and a half of the season — winning just 1 game from January 20th through March 7. They even lost to LSU, Mississippi State and South Carolina along the way, all 3 of whom lost their opening games this week and are now done for the season unless one of the ancillary postseason tournaments comes calling. 

Nate Oats is 2-1 SU against Chris Beard’s Rebels over the last 3 years, including a 93-74 win in Oxford earlier this year. In that game, the Tide only connected on 9 2-point attempts, as they hoisted up 45 perimeter shots and knocked down 17 of them en route to 1.26 points per possession. They also won the rebounding battle, turned the ball over just 6 times and converted 24 of their 26 free-throw attempts. 

Ole Miss’ path to success involves slowing this game down and benefiting from some positive three-point variance, but that’s easier said than done. Alabama loves to push the pace while shooting threes at the highest rate in the country. Because of that, if they’re hitting shots, they’re tough to beat. If not, they can lose to anyone. That said, are we sure Ole Miss will have the legs for this type of game? I’m not. 

If Bama is on, it’s going to be tough for Ole Miss to match their output, as the Rebels are 14th in the conference in adjusted offensive efficiency and 15th in effective field-goal percentage. Moreover, they don’t create easy chances for themselves given they are also the SEC’s 2nd-worst in offensive rebounding rate and free throw rate. Defensively, the Rebels are the league’s worst in free-throw rate allowed and 3-point rate allowed, which is music to Alabama’s ears. We all like Cinderella stories in March, but on paper, it’s going to be a tough test for Ole Miss on Friday night. 

Ole Miss vs Alabama prediction: Alabama -11.5 (-110) available at time of publishing. Playable to -12.
